Historically, these laws were passed to avoid the dead spouse from leaving the survivor destitute, therefore shifting the concern of care to the social well-being system. In England, the procedures of wills are relaxed for soldiers that express their desires on active duty; any type of such will is known as a serviceman's will. A minority of territories even identify the credibility of nuncupative wills (oral wills), particularly for military workers or vendor seafarers.

A details legacy is when you want to leave behind a specific piece of your property to a recipient. For example, if you intend to leave your stamp collection to your nephew who accumulates stamps, you can make a certain legacy. Various other jurisdictions will either overlook the effort or hold that the entire will was in fact revoked. A testator might also be able to withdraw by the physical act of one more (as would be required if he or she is literally immobilized), if this is done in their visibility and in the presence of witnesses. Some jurisdictions might presume that a will has actually been damaged if it had actually been last seen in the possession of the testator but is located mutilated or can not be discovered after their death.
